ABOUTLOGIN
  • svg-iconSIGN UP
  • svg-iconLOGIN
  • svg-iconGET HELP
  • About
  • Careers
  • Blog

Scott Lupo in Santa Cruz, CA

Santa Cruz is the only city in California where we found Scott Lupo.

All Filters
2
Scott Thomas Lupo, 59
Resides in Santa Cruz, CA
Includes Address(4) Phone(3) Email(1)
See Results
Scott Lupo
Resides in Santa Cruz, CA
Includes Address(1) Phone(1) Email(2)
See Results
Scott Lupo
Resides in Santa Cruz, CA
Includes Address(1) Phone(1)
See Results
Scott Lupo
Resides in Santa Cruz, CA
Includes Address(1) Email(1)
See Results
Scott Lupo
Resides in Santa Cruz, CA
Includes Address(2) Phone(1) Email(2)
See Results